dc.description.abstractSyzygium is one of large genera of the flowering plants. In order 10 simplify the identificalion, a classification is required, e.g. based on degree of pelal fUSion, leaf size and fruit size. Due 10 variations of vegetative and generative characters, a correlation analysis was carried out. The aim of this research is to know the correlation between degree of petal fusion, leaf length and fruit diameter. The result of this research showed that there is positive correlation between those three variables. The increase of leaf size will increase fruit size and petal lobe depth.en
